Understand the math behind your Google rating.
Google calculates the average of all submitted ratings. A single 5-star review has only a small effect when a profile already has many reviews.
The formula is: needed = current_reviews × (target - current) / (5 - target). The higher the current rating, the more 5-star reviews may be needed.
When a profile has few reviews, each new rating changes the average more significantly. That makes it important to start collecting positive reviews early.
Google considers more than the average star rating. Review volume and recency also matter, so regular new reviews are at least as important as the average itself.
